Hello students, welcome to Kwickprep. You type one line, and a computer writes a poem or draws a picture. Is it really creating, or is it guessing? Today we will learn the types of generative AI and how to try it safely. We will also see where it is used, and its benefits and limits.

First, let us compare two kinds of AI. Discriminative AI looks at data and sorts it or predicts a label, like deciding whether an email is spam. Generative AI creates new content, such as text, images, music or video, that did not exist before.

How does it work, in simple words? A generative model is trained on a huge amount of examples, like books, web pages, photos and songs. From these examples it learns patterns, but it does not truly understand meaning the way we do. A prompt is the instruction you give it, such as write a four line poem on monsoon. It then predicts the most likely next word, or the next part of an image, again and again, until the answer is complete.

Generative AI comes in four main types. Text generators write essays, answers, emails and even program code, for example ChatGPT and Gemini. Image generators turn a text prompt into a picture, like DALL-E and Adobe Firefly. Audio generators create a human-like voice or a piece of music, like ElevenLabs and Suno. Video generators create short video clips from a prompt, like Sora and Veo.

Before we try a tool, let us learn four safety rules. Use only a tool that your school or teacher has approved for the class. Check the age rule, because many tools allow only users aged thirteen or above, or need a parent's permission. Never type personal details like your full name, phone number, address or your photos. Always check facts from your textbook or teacher, because the tool can be wrong.

The quality of the answer depends on your prompt. Tell about Diwali is vague, but explain Diwali in five simple lines gives a focused answer. Draw a cat is weak, while a cartoon cat under a blue sky tells the tool the style and background. Make a poem is unclear, but a four line poem about the monsoon sets the length and the topic.

Pause the video and think. You ask a chatbot, who won the cricket match played this morning? But the model only learnt from data up to last year, and it has no search feature turned on. What will it do, and can you trust its answer? It may make up a confident but wrong answer, so always check recent facts from a reliable news source.

Generative AI is now used across many industries. In education, teachers create quizzes and students get explanations in simple words. In healthcare, it drafts medical notes and helps researchers design new medicines, but doctors check everything. In business, it writes emails and runs customer support chatbots. In media, it helps make posters and dubbing into Indian languages. In software, programmers use it to write and fix code faster.

Now let us look at the benefits. It saves time by writing first drafts and doing routine work quickly. It supports creativity by suggesting new ideas, stories and designs. It can translate content into many Indian languages, so more people can learn in their mother tongue. It is available at any time, like a patient helper who explains again and again.

Now the limitations, which are just as important. Hallucination means the model gives a confident answer that is simply false, like a made-up fact or a fake book name. It can repeat bias found in its training data, for example showing only men when asked to draw a doctor. Deepfakes are fake photos, voices or videos of real people, which can spread lies or cheat people. There are also doubts about copyright of the content it learnt from, and what you type may be stored.

So how should a student use generative AI honestly? Use it to understand a topic, but do your homework and exams in your own words. Be open and tell your teacher when AI helped you with a project. Never create fake pictures, voices or videos of real people, because it can hurt them and may break the law.

Finally, what does the future look like? Multimodal models will read text, look at images, listen and speak, all in one tool. AI agents will plan a task and complete several steps, like booking a train ticket after you approve it. We will see more tools that work well in Indian languages, including efforts supported by the government's IndiaAI Mission. Governments are also making stronger rules, such as labels that clearly mark AI-made content.

Let us recap today's lesson. Generative AI has four main types: text, image, audio and video. Try it safely with an approved tool, share no personal data, and always check the facts. It is used in education, healthcare, business, media and software. It brings speed and creativity, but also hallucinations, bias and deepfakes, so a human must always stay in charge.
